Chinese Macao Gaming Show confirms new and expanded Slot Experience Center

The Macao Gaming Show (MGS) has confirmed the return of the ground-breaking Slot Experience Center (SEC) to this year’s show at the Venetian Macao, 17-19 November 2015. The popular initiative provides games developers the opportunity to showcase their products to players and senior slot experts during private trials at the exhibition, and to make viable adjustments that enable the products to be brought to market earlier.

The Slot Experience Center at MGS serves as a valuable test-bed for manufacturers, with the trials delivering a unique insight and in-depth feedback on their latest products. Following its debut at MGS 2013, the Slot Experience Center has become a staple part of the annual event and this year the show is hoping to extend the initiative to facilitate even more opportunities for feedback.

MGS, the fastest growing exhibition on the gaming events calendar, will bring players and senior level slot experts together with game developers, to evaluate the games across a number of criteria. These include game theme, graphics, sound and the overall playing experience with awards going to the EGM manufacturers who receive the highest number of votes. In 2014, the SEC saw Konami, Aruze Gaming, Aristocrat and Laxino winning awards in the Best Theme, Best Music, Best Playing Experience and Best Graphics respectively.

Praising the success of previous SECs at the Macao Gaming Show, Events Director and General Manager Marina Wong said: “The Slot Experience Center is not about hard sell: it’s about honest dialogue and games innovation. It’s about gaining trust-worthy advice and indicators to help move technology and product development forward.“

She added: “The Experience Center has been a resounding success over the years and we believe it’s an excellent opportunity for manufacturers to receive honest, insightful feedback from slot professionals, enthusiasts, and even causal players.”
